Transaction 62bf16ec47dc8f46b0c0d045c6b4071715482272f3866530c82355a98aad2f2e
1 Input
2 Outputs
- 62bf16ec47dc8f46b0c0d045c6b4071715482272f3866530c82355a98aad2f2e:0
- 62bf16ec47dc8f46b0c0d045c6b4071715482272f3866530c82355a98aad2f2e:1
value 887822
address 139sbx4aoY1yhooBRZ16VfFQmsdu4kcUkt
value 4750000
address 172qkQVcSoCngpnoth2zmsBeXAjL2UPvdn